Colaba: cement on barter

Luxury towers here specify a single brand of OPC 53 for the structure and white cement for finishing; we hold brand consistency for the full project.

Colaba runs from Regal Circle down to Navy Nagar, a long thin strip where Grade II heritage blocks, 1960s societies and the odd plot behind Colaba Causeway sit within a few hundred metres of each other.

What comes up here is boutique: 12 to 25 flats per building, large 3 and 4 BHKs, sea-facing on the Cuffe Parade side, and almost always a redevelopment of an existing society rather than a fresh plot.

Cement is delivered in 200 to 300-bag tempo loads at night and stacked inside the building floor by floor because there is no godown space; we hold stock at our godown and feed the site daily.

Buyers are old Colaba families upgrading within the neighbourhood and corporate tenants; resale is quick because supply is so limited. That is who our inventory desk sells to when we take units here, which is why material-only barter in Colaba is typically 8–15% below the developer's rate rather than deeper.

Settlement

Three ways to pay for the work

Zero cash outflow
100%

100% barter

Entire work-order value settled in flats

Flats allotted at 35% below the project's current market rate. Best when the developer wants zero cash outflow on structure.

Most common
50/50

50% barter + 50% payment

Half in flats, half on running-account bills

Flats at 35% below market for the barter half; RA bills for the cash half. The most common structure for redevelopment schemes.

Cash

100% payment

Standard contracting on RA bills

We also take pure cash contracts on competitive item rates when the developer prefers to keep inventory.

Process

From drawings to registered flats

01

Share drawings

Send architectural and structural drawings, elevation, floor plates and the RERA number. We take off quantities and build an item-rate BOQ.

02

Receive the quote

Quote per sq ft built-up or item-rate, separately for conventional RCC, Mivan or traditional as the structure demands. Barter, 50/50 and cash options side by side.

03

Fix the barter rate

Flats in the same project are valued at 35% below the current market rate. Work-order value ÷ barter rate = carpet area allotted to us.

04

Sign work order + ATS

Work order with milestone table, barter MOU and registered agreements for sale on the allotted flats. Escrow or milestone release as your lender permits.

05

Build and settle

Mobilise in 15 days. Milestones certified by your PMC; flats released to us against certified value, RA bills for any cash component.
